nVent Electric PLC has scheduled its Annual General Meeting for May 17, 2024, and has made proxy materials available to shareholders.

Summary

  • nVent Electric PLC will hold its Annual General Meeting on May 17, 2024.
  • Shareholders are encouraged to vote on proposals outlined in the proxy materials.
  • The proxy materials, including the Annual Report on Form 10-K, Notice of Annual General Meeting, Proxy Statement, and Irish Statutory Financial Statements, are available online.
  • Shareholders can request a free paper or email copy of the materials before May 3, 2024.
  • The meeting will take place in London, United Kingdom, but may be held at an alternative location, date, or time if necessary, with a public announcement to follow.
  • Voting matters include the election of director nominees, executive compensation, auditor ratification, and authorizations related to share issuance and re-allotment under Irish law.

Key Dates

DateDescription
March 12, 2024Date of email sent to shareholders regarding the Annual Meeting
March 20, 2024Record date for holders to vote common shares
May 3, 2024Deadline to request a paper or email copy of proxy materials
May 12, 2024Deadline to vote plan shares
May 15, 2024Deadline to vote common shares
May 17, 2024Annual General Meeting date
